Dear Sandy, 


Will #AB1822 be double-referred to the health committee, or is this out of your jurisdiction now?
  1. There is no scientific proof that DD/ID people can be treated in a cookie-cutter facility to become 'normalized' to stand trial.
  2. This is an expensive bill because the DDS will have to fund the treatment of a DD/ID person, as they are tasked with the welfare of their consumers
  3. So long as DD/ID SPED students are excluded from mainstream health education, we should not be forcing them into perpetual criminalization of their sexual behaviors that are judged as illegal.  
When is the Public Safety hearing, and the deadline for opposition to be registered, and in-person testimony? We are requesting to appear on the agenda.
